A Valid License and Insurance

When you’re investigating different professionals that offer Sub Zero repair near you, a license and insurance are the first things you’re going to want to look for. Not only are appliance repair services required to have both in New York County, but they’re also a sign that the professional is reliable and committed to offering top-quality results.

A license confirms that a Times Square, NY Sub Zero repair technician has received the professional training that’s necessary to accurately diagnose and repair issues with your fridge. Insurance protects you from having to pay for any problems that may occur while the contractor is working on your New York County property. For instance, if the technician damages your house or appliance in any way or is injured, their insurance policies will cover the cost of any necessary repairs and/or medical care that may be needed.

Don’t just ask the companies that specialize in Sub Zero repair near you if they’re licensed and insured; ask to see proof of both. Both a license and insurance can be costly to maintain, and unfortunately, there are some appliance repair contractors that claim they have both, but in reality, have neither. That’s why it’s important to ask for proof and to confirm the validity of both. Any reputable Times Square, NY Sub Zero repair technician will be more than happy to share this information with you.

Some information about Times Square, NY

Times Square is a major commercial intersection, tourist destination, entertainment center, and neighborhood in the Midtown Manhattan section of New York City, at the junction of Broadway and Seventh Avenue. Brightly lit by numerous billboards and advertisements, it stretches from West 42nd to West 47th Streets, and is sometimes referred to as ‘the Crossroads of the World’, ‘the Center of the Universe’, ‘the heart of the Great White Way’, and ‘the heart of the world’. One of the world’s busiest pedestrian areas, it is also the hub of the Broadway Theater District and a major center of the world’s entertainment industry. Times Square is one of the world’s most visited tourist attractions, drawing an estimated 50 million visitors annually. Approximately 330,000 people pass through Times Square daily, many of them tourists, while over 460,000 pedestrians walk through Times Square on its busiest days.

When Manhattan Island was first settled by the Dutch, three small streams united near what is now 10th Avenue and 40th Street. These three streams formed the ‘Great Kill’ (Dutch: Grote Kil). From there the Great Kill wound through the low-lying Reed Valley, known for fish and waterfowl, and emptied into a deep bay in the Hudson River at the present 42nd Street. The name was retained in a tiny hamlet, Great Kill, that became a center for carriage-making, as the upland to the south and east became known as Longacre.

Before and after the American Revolution, the area belonged to John Morin Scott, a general of the New York militia, in which he served under George Washington. Scott’s manor house was at what is currently 43rd Street, surrounded by countryside used for farming and breeding horses. In the first half of the 19th century, it became one of the prized possessions of John Jacob Astor, who made a second fortune selling off lots to hotels and other real estate concerns as the city rapidly spread uptown.

By 1872, the area had become the center of New York’s horse carriage industry. The locality had not previously been given a name, and city authorities called it Longacre Square after Long Acre in London, where the horse and carriage trade was centered in that city. William Henry Vanderbilt owned and ran the American Horse Exchange there. In 1910, it became the Winter Garden Theatre.
